SAE J393:2017 pdf free.Nomenclature – Wheels, Hubs, and Rims for Commercial Vehicles
RIM CENTERLINE: An imaginary line bisecting the rim width of a disc wheel or demountable rim – equivalent to“rim center plane” (Figure 2).
HUB ASSEMBLY: A system which provides the interface between an axle and one or two-disc wheels (Figures 4 and 7).
WHEEL ASSEMBLY FOR DEMOUNTABLE RIM (SPOKE WHEEL ASSEMBLY): A system which provides the interface between an axle and one or two demountable rims (Appendices A and B).
HIGHWAY USE: A speed of over 30 mph on improved roads.
RADIAL RUNOUT: Total indicator reading in the radial direction, taken at the rim bead seat, for one revolution, with the wheel located on the specified datum (Figure 5).
LATERAL RUNOUT: Total indicator reading in the lateral direction, taken at the rim flange, for one revolution, with the wheel located on the specified datum (Figure 6).
DATUM: The combination of physical features used to locate a wheel during runout measurement (Figures 5 and 6).
AVERAGE RADIAL RUNOUT: The total indicator reading obtained by simultaneously averaging radial runout readings at both rim bead seats (Figure 5).
AVERAGE LATERAL RUNOUT: The total indicator reading obtained by simultaneously averaging lateral runout readings at both rim flanges (Figure 6).
ABS RING: A ferromagnetic annular feature or component presenting a series of uniform air gaps for sensing wheel rotational speed (Figure 4).
INSET WHEEL: A wheel so constructed that the rim centerline is located inboard of the attachment face of the disc. Inset is the distance from the attachment face of the disc to the centerline of the rim (Figure 3).
ZEROSET WHEEL: A wheel so constructed that the rim centerline is coincident with the attachment face of the disc (Figure 3).
OUTSET WHEEL: A wheel so constructed that the rim centerline is located outboard of the attachment face of the disc.Outset is the distance from the attachment face of the disc to the centerline of the rim (Figure 3).
